The 98-inch C735 featuring Google TV is the largest in the series, with QLED technology 4K resolution that delivers immersive entertainment viewing with stunning Hollywood standard color performance. TCL designed the 98-inch C735 to emulate the best seat in the movie house: when sitting about three meters away from the 98C735 screen at home, users enjoy the same 60-degrees field of view as watching a gigantic 30-meters screen from the middle row, center seats at a movie theater. Both 98C735 and 75C735 are QLED TVs and can deliver Quantum dot natural colors to you. Open your window-like extra-large screen TV and soak up a thousand shade of colors exclusive to sunrise.
The XL Collection’s 75C935 and 75C835 TVs are powered by Mini LED backlight which TCL developed to ensure top class viewing even in a bright room. With thousands of Mini LED lights, the XL Collection screens display HDR content at its best by delivering incredible brightness with richer light and shadows. C935’s 1,920 Local Dimming Zones also ensure brilliant blacks, bright whites, vivid colors, and even more fine definition in images. All the TVs in the XL Collection support most of HDR technologies and formats available in the market, such as Dolby Vision IQ, Dolby Vision, HLG, HDR10 and HDR10+.
Gaming and sports… are now even bigger!
For gamers seeking the ultimate smooth gaming experience, the XL Collection Mini LED TVs 75C935 and 75C845 - offer low input lag and a Variable Refresh Rate of up to 144Hz and both TVs support HDMI 2.1 input.
